Additional Program Conditions:

  1. BIOL 101 does not count toward this program.
  2. A maximum of 2.0 failed units is permitted.
  3. Normally, a maximum of 3.0 SCBUS units is permitted.
  4. Learn more about Co-op program requirements and Science Faculty work term report guidelines.

Notes

  1. 100- and 200-level BIOL electives should be chosen to satisfy prerequisites for upper-year BIOL electives.
  2. BIOL labs may be needed to satisfy upper-year courses as prerequisites.
  3. BIOL 130L, BIOL 240L, or BIOL 273L is recommended if BIOL 130, BIOL 240, or BIOL 273 count as a BIOL elective.
  4. Alternative program electives may be substituted with permission from the program advisor.
  5. HRM 200 and MSCI 311 are recommended program electives.
